Lock-On: Soldier of Fortune

So Lock-On is one of my older level 40s, but using him during the recent High Noon event has shown that his build is a bit lackluster currently. He started life as a general munitions character (built off of how the Soldier worked back in the day,) and while I do like that design conceptually, I'm not convinced that it works particularly effectively anymore.

So my question to you, learned build masters, is what would you advise as a good DPS munitions build. My only request is that it feature several if not all of the munitions weapons, and that it not be locked down into using dual pistols. I have a few character built in that manner, and I don't want to run another.

Thank you in advance :)

    Here's a non-pistol Muni build to try:

    (Unnamed Build) - Freeform
    v2.4.2-29

    Super Stats
    Level 6: Ego (Primary)
    Level 10: Recovery (Secondary)
    Level 15: Constitution (Secondary)

    Talents
    Level 1: The Scourge (Con: 10, Ego: 10, Rec: 10, End: 8)
    Level 6: Ascetic (Con: 5, Ego: 5)
    Level 9: Quick Recovery (Con: 5, Rec: 5)
    Level 12: Worldly (Ego: 5, Rec: 5)
    Level 15: Boundless Reserves (Con: 5, End: 5)
    Level 18: Daredevil (Ego: 5, End: 5)
    Level 21: Amazing Stamina (Rec: 5, End: 5)

    Powers
    Level 1: Gunslinger (advantages)
    Level 1: Submachinegun Burst (Rank 2, Rank 3, Extra Bullets)
    Level 6: Concentration (advantages)
    Level 8: Targeting Computer (Rank 2, Rank 3)
    Level 11: Killer Instinct
    Level 14: Conviction (Rank 2, Rank 3)
    Level 17: Gatling Gun (Rank 2, Listen to Reason)
    Level 20: Assault Rifle (Rank 2, Uncompromising)
    Level 23: Resurgence (Rank 2)
    Level 26: Energy Shield (Rank 2)
    Level 29: Mini Mines (Stim Pack)
    Level 32: Lock N Load (Rank 2)
    Level 35: Sniper Rifle (Rank 2, Rank 3)
    Level 38: Thundering Return (advantages)
    Adv. Points: 33/36

    Travel Powers
    Level 6:
    Level 35:

    Specializations
    Ego: Force of Will (2/2)
    Ego: Insight (3/3)
    Ego: Follow Through (3/3)
    Ego: Sixth Sense (2/3)
    Guardian: Fortified Gear (3/3)
    Guardian: Ruthless (2/2)
    Guardian: Find the Mark (2/3)
    Guardian: The Best Defense (3/3)
    Vindicator: Aggressive Stance (2/2)
    Vindicator: Merciless (3/3)
    Vindicator: Focused Strikes (3/3)
    Vindicator: Mass Destruction (2/3)
    Mastery: Ego Mastery (1/1)

    To optimize AR's single-target dps, build 3x Furious w/ SMG Burst, apply Armor Piercing w/ Gatling, then channel AR- tapping Gatling every so often to refresh Furious (and Armor Piercing). AoE can be w/ SMG (if w/in 50ft) or w/ Gatling (if long range), and you could opt for the 3-pt shield adv on SMG if you want a more defensive option.

    I threw Sniper Rifle in there for fun, and if you want a >100ft attack- though something else like Rocket could take its place. Mini Mines can also be used at anytime to get the self-heal adv. Gears mostly for Ego, w/ some Con and Rec/End.

  • After many months, I finally got my Soldier AT the right gear to make her a glass cannon again. If you want to make your muni do as much DPS as possible, look at this thread and apply the gear to your character: https://www.arcgames.com/en/forums/championsonline#/discussion/comment/12788623

    It may take a lot of work and funds to collect the Justice Gear, OV gloves, Bolstering pieces, Ascii mod and DUC but trust me, the damage you do is well worth it. Once you have 3 stacks of Furious and hit Lock N Load, you can mow down enemies in seconds.
